Ana Walshe, 39, of Cohasset, Massachusetts, was reported missing Wednesday after being last seen at her home around 4 a.m. New Year's Day.
Cohasett, Massachusetts police chief William Quigley, who is searching for missing woman Ana Walshe, said Saturday "every hour we're getting more concerned for her well-being."
Walshe, 39, of Cohasset, Massachusetts, was reported missing Wednesday after leaving her home around 4 a.m. New Year's Day to get into a rideshare heading toin Boston to Washington D.C., Cohasset Police Chief William Quigley told reporters Friday morning. Ana Walshe commuted from Massachusetts to Washington, D.C., each week to work at a real estate job, her friends told WCVB.
Walshe was head to D.C. where she works for the real estate company Tishman Speyer, which told Fox News Digital that it was assisting authorities"in their ongoing search for our beloved colleague, Ana, and are praying for her safe return."
